What is hex #E0A5BC Color?

Kobi (Hex code: E0A5BC) Thumbnail

The color name of hex code #E0A5BC is Kobi. The RGB values are (224, 165, 188) which means it is composed of 39% red, 29% green and 33% blue. The CMYK color codes, used in printers, are C:0 M:26 Y:16 K:12. In the HSV/HSB scale, #E0A5BC has a hue of 337°, 26% saturation and a brightness value of 88%.

Complementary Palette

The complement of #E0A5BC is #A5E0C9 which is called Sea Foam Green. Complementary colors are those found at the opposite ends of the color wheel. Thus, as per the RGB system, the best contrast to #E0A5BC color is offered by #A5E0C9. The complementary color palette is easiest to use and work with. Studies have shown that contrasting color palette is the best way to grab a viewer's attention.

Split-Complementary Palette

As per the RGB color wheel, the split-complementary colors of #E0A5BC are #A5E0AC (Celadon) and #A5DAE0 (Crystal). A split-complementary color palette consists of the main color along with those on either side (30°) of the complementary color. Based on our research, usage of split-complementary palettes is on the rise online, especially in graphics and web sites designs. It may be because it is not as contrasting as the complementary color palette and, hence, results in a combination which is pleasant to the eyes.
